COZY, FAMILY HOME IN LOERIE PARK, GEORGE

This house is situated in a tranquil area and consists of 3 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, open plan kitchen/lounge/dining room, entrance hall, study, laundry, patio with built-in braai & double garage.

The rental amount does not include electricity (pre-paid), basic cost as charged by George municipality, water, refuse, sewerage, alarm (if any), gas (if any) or garden service.

The qualifying, combined, monthly income is R53 400.00.

Welcome to George, a picturesque town in the heart of the Garden Route in South Africa’s Western Cape Province. George is a haven for nature lovers, adventure seekers, and those looking for a high quality of life.George is surrounded by the majestic Outeniqua Mountains and lush forests, offering a backdrop of natural beauty that enhances everyday living.
